description 碩士 === 世新大學 === 資訊管理學研究所(含碩專班) === 95 === More popular of the Internet, more security issues are concerned for the Internet connections. Nowadays, VPN is becoming a very popular method to secure connections on the Internet. By a VPN connection, both terminals can exchange data in a secured tunnel which keeps data integrity and confidentiality. However, establishing a VPN connection costs much CPU process time and many hardware resources. Part of CPU and memory are occupied by encryption and decryption process. Therefore, a dedicate processor to execute decryption/encryption will save much CPU process time and many other hardware resources. Cavium Networks present a series of hardware based on MIPS processor, called Octeon, which provides coprocessor to process decryption/encryption work for faster execution. In this thesis, an open source VPN software Openswan on Octeon is modified to replace its VPN decryption/encryption functions by hardware accelerator. The accuracy and performance of encryption and decryption processes are validated by comparing hardware and software solutions.
